Jaka jest różnica między narzędziem Web Deployment Tool 2.1 a narzędziem Web Deployment Tool 2.1 dla serwerów hostingowych?

19

Instalator platformy internetowej firmy Microsoft wymienia „Web Deployment Tool 2.1” z datą premiery 4/11/2011 oraz „Web Deployment Tool 2.1 for Hosting Servers” z datą premiery 4/8/2011. O ile widzę (klikając Dodaj, a następnie Instaluj) zawartość jest taka sama: samo narzędzie wdrażania, SQL Server 2008 R2 Management Objects (zależność), SQL Server Native Client (zależność) i SQL Server systemowe typy CLR (Zależność).

Czy są one rzeczywiście różne, a jeśli tak, to w jaki sposób? (A jeśli nie, to po co wymieniać je oba?)

Nick Jones
źródło

Odpowiedzi:

19

Masz rację, zawartość jest taka sama. Jednak pakiet „for Hosting Servers” zainstaluje wiele innych zależności, takich jak IIS, jeśli jeszcze nie są obecne.

Jonathan
źródło
Czy jest jakiś sposób, aby wiedzieć, jakie są wszystkie te zależności? Jeśli instaluję to na istniejącym serwerze internetowym, która wersja byłaby lepsza?
ulty4life
1
ulty4life Wybrałbym narzędzie Web Deployment Tool (bez hostingu) i sprawdzę, czy zaspokoi ono twoje potrzeby (powinno to dotyczyć istniejącego serwera).
cederlof
1
Wciąż wygląda to tak samo dla Web Deploy 3.6
spankmaster79
3

Dodałbym również: opcja „for Hosting Servers” instaluje „Web Agent wdrażania usługi”, który musi być serwerem odbierającym podczas migracji przez sieć za pomocą msdeploy.exe.

Jonesome przywraca Monikę
źródło